Title :
Improved groundwall insulation system for air cooled generators

Abstract :
A new insulation system has been developed for coils that are used in air cooled generator stator windings. The power density of these air cooled generators can be increased through better thermal performance of the stator coil insulation. The approach taken to achieve better thermal performance is to reduce the groundwall insulation thickness and at the same time improve the coil´s dielectric parameters. This paper describes a new air cooled stator coil insulation design that incorporate design improvements in three major areas of the coil´s insulation components. These are the groundwall insulation, the Roebel filler material, and the external corona suppression. Each of these improvements are reviewed with respect to the role they play in the overall dielectric performance of the new coil design
